What Are the Safety Advantages of Wingda LiFePO4 Batteries?
Wingda LiFePO4 batteries feature superior thermal and chemical stability, significantly reducing risks of fire, explosion, or thermal runaway common in other lithium-ion variants. This enhanced safety profile makes them dependable for critical applications where operational security is paramount.
How Does the Lifespan of Wingda LiFePO4 Batteries Compare to Other Battery Types?
These batteries boast thousands of charge cycles, often exceeding 3,000 to 5,000 cycles, vastly outlasting conventional lead-acid or typical lithium-ion batteries. Their durable chemistry translates to fewer replacements, lowering long-term costs and ensuring sustained power availability.
Why Is Deep Discharge Tolerance Important for Wingda LiFePO4 Batteries?
Wingda LiFePO4 batteries can endure deep discharges without lasting damage, maintaining capacity and performance over time. This attribute allows for reliable power delivery even under demanding conditions where frequent deep cycling occurs.
Which Charging Characteristics Make Wingda LiFePO4 Batteries Efficient?
They support fast charging at high currents and maintain a high round-trip efficiency, meaning less energy loss occurs during charging and discharging cycles. This improves energy use and shortens downtime, enhancing overall system productivity.
How Does Low Self-Discharge Rate Benefit Wingda LiFePO4 Battery Users?
Having a low self-discharge rate means Wingda LiFePO4 batteries retain charge for extended periods when not in active use, ideal for backup power, solar energy storage, or intermittent applications where batteries may sit idle yet need to remain ready.
What Are the Maintenance Requirements for Wingda LiFePO4 Batteries?
Wingda LiFePO4 batteries require minimal maintenance—no electrolyte topping or conditioning—reducing operational overhead and downtime compared to traditional batteries. Their robust design simplifies lifecycle management in commercial and industrial deployments.
